PaydayBooks is designed to be set up in under 5 minutes. Here's exactly how it works, step by step.

Step 1: Install from the Shopify App Store

Go to the PaydayBooks listing in the Shopify App Store and click "Add app." Shopify will ask you to confirm the installation. Click "Install" and you'll be taken to the PaydayBooks setup wizard inside your Shopify admin.

Step 2: Connect QuickBooks Online

Click "Connect QuickBooks." You'll be redirected to Intuit's login page. Sign in with your QuickBooks Online credentials and click "Authorize." PaydayBooks will receive a secure token — your password is never shared with us.

Step 3: Pick your bank account and clearing account

PaydayBooks needs to know two accounts in your QuickBooks chart of accounts:

  • Bank account: The account where Shopify deposits your payouts (the same one on your bank statement)
  • Clearing account: A temporary "holding" account used to route gross sales through before the net amount is deposited. If you don't have one yet, you can create it from the setup wizard — it takes about 10 seconds.

PaydayBooks auto-detects your accounts from QuickBooks and presents them in a dropdown. Most merchants are done with this step in under a minute.

Step 4: Preview your first sync

Before anything is posted to QuickBooks, PaydayBooks shows you a preview of exactly what will be created for your most recent payout. You'll see the SalesReceipt amount, any RefundReceipt, and the Deposit. Verify it looks right.

Step 5: Confirm — you're done

Click "Confirm and sync." PaydayBooks posts the entries to QuickBooks and sets up automatic syncing every 6 hours going forward. No more manual work required.

What happens after setup?

Every 6 hours, PaydayBooks checks for new Shopify payouts. If a new payout has been released, it gets synced to QuickBooks automatically. You can check the PaydayBooks dashboard any time to see recent syncs, review any errors, and manually trigger a sync if you need it right away.
